Versant Power Electricity Rates
Versant Power residential customers pay an average of 28.1¢/kWh (EIA-861, 2024, bundled service), or about $141.76 per month — 16% above the Maine state average. See what your bill looks like at that rate below.

What a Versant Power bill looks like by usage
Monthly cost at Versant Power's effective 28.1¢/kWh rate vs the Maine average of 24.3¢/kWh. U.S. homes average about 863 kWh/month.
| Monthly usage | Versant Power | ME average |
|---|---|---|
| 500 kWh | $140.40 | $121.45 |
| 750 kWh | $210.60 | $182.18 |
| 1,000 kWh | $280.80 | $242.90 |
| 1,250 kWh | $351.00 | $303.63 |
| 1,500 kWh | $421.20 | $364.35 |
| 2,000 kWh | $561.60 | $485.80 |

Frequently asked questions
Versant Power's average residential rate is 28.1¢/kWh (EIA-861, 2024). That's the effective bundled rate — total residential revenue divided by kWh sold — so it includes supply, delivery, and riders, not just the advertised energy charge.
